Fitbit Sync
I got FitBit to Sync finally with my custom rom.
I used the Build Prop Editor from JRummy. play.google.com/store/apps/details?id=com.jrummy.apps.build.prop.editor
change the ro.product.model=GT-I9505G
and ro.product.manufacturer=samsung
and save those settings, reboot, and now Fitbit will try to sync now. YAY! :victory:

Note 2 & Fitbit/Bluetooth Problems
I came here looking for answers/help with my bluetooth... but so far I haven't really been able to find anything that's actually helpful. I can share with everything what I've been able to find out, though.
I have a Galaxy Note 2 running stock on Android 4.4.2 and I have the Fitbit Flex. I used to sync without any problems but after my phone updated to 4.4.2 it no longer syncs. After researching for a few days... it seems the problem is with the Update itself... it reduces power or range of Bluetooth... that's why the Flex cannot sync to it. However, I have discovered an quick fix to that:
When syncing, just place your phone on top of your Flex band and it will sync up without any problems. This has become my temporary solution. Someone else suggest another quick fix would be to turn on Mobile Hotspot on your phone... that is suppose to increase the Bluetooth Power.
I also learned that Samsung won't update the Note 2 to 4.4.4, which would have fixed this problem.. but instead will Update the Note 2 to Lollipop... but that date is still unannounced.
If anyone has any ideas on how to really fix this problem... I'm all ears. The only solution I found was to open up the phone and do something to the bluetooth chip inside... but I forgot where I found that solution.

I would add that instead of removing the apps right away, it's probably better to freeze (disable) them and see if that affects anything. If everything is good after freezing, they can be removed for good. And if something is messed up, just defrost the app in question.
Titanium Backup Pro can freeze apps, but you can also use other utilities that are free, like Advanced Tools from Play Store.
